Best Practices for Documenting Eczema Exams
Strong eczema physical exam documentation must specify the morphology of the lesions—such as erythematous papules, vesicles, or thickened, leathery plaques (lichenification)—and their precise anatomical distribution, noting whether they are in flexural folds or on exposed surfaces. It should also document the presence of secondary changes, such as excoriations from scratching or signs of secondary infection like honey-colored crusting, to justify the treatment plan.
